| Re: I Like To Join This Forum And Learn The Local Culture by delishpot: 8:49pm On Apr 01, 2016 |
Welcome to Naija, have you discovered any Naija food, drink, fashion and culture you love? If so, please share with us ![]() Nigeria has a lot of cultures I guess the few things we have in common are *We respect elders *We do not like people smelling food we offer them especially if they end up not eating it. *We greet neighbours when we see them making it a duty to greet those older than you first before they greet you. *Give transport fare to younger guests or visitors when they pay you a visit *Offer food/drinks to guests when they pay you a visit *We don't like Amebo Ehmmm, when I remember others, I go let you know am. For now try sabi those ones. |
